This company specializes in retailing new and used CDs with a franchise store model. They currently have over 150 stores (most
are franchises, the company has some company-owned stores). The unit economics are quite compelling.
The revenues grew at 83%, same-store sales increased 14% during
'97. The past results are below:

1996: $4.9M in revenues, .10 in earnings
1997: $9.0M in revenues, .23 in earnings EPS up 130%!!!!!

Management has given guidance that they are on track to do
.50 in earnings for '98 with revenues over $12M in top line growth. The company is poised for even more growth in '99.
The management team is quite impressive. The CEO has a franchise background and was CFO of Sonic Corp (SONC) and helped to bring
them public in '91. He knows the ins and outs of franchising and has built several businesses. The CFO of CDWI is equally as impressive and has over 12 years of experience with a big six firm. In addition,
senior management owns half of the company. It seems that their interests are aligned with the shareholders. Does anyone have any comments about this stock?
